The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) was advised on Tuesday to authorize Pfizer’s COVID-19 vaccine for children between the ages of 5 and 11. The FDA’s Vaccines and Related Biological Products Advisory Committee made the recommendation. Seventeen panel members voted yes to recommend the authorization. One abstained. The vote came after lengthy presentations and discussions about whether the benefits of the jab outweigh the risks for young children. Pfizer and FDA experts were unable to say the vaccine can prevent transmission of the CCP (Chinese Communist Party) virus, which causes COVID-19.
